Output e3cdc77aa59650eb42b1fb28671041683a8a8c6f9effb1a1d432ab21e33d4da9:246

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fe20ffadc20d8ae6051e3fb0a4526053650690340bc2fbb780ff242a29996d9a
address
bc1plcs0ltwzpk9wvpg787c2g5nq2djsdyp5p0p0hduqlujz52vedkdqvg92fm
transaction
e3cdc77aa59650eb42b1fb28671041683a8a8c6f9effb1a1d432ab21e33d4da9
spent
true